Zip
The Takeaway
Zip's lock-in isn't procurement software elegance — it's being the first to embed payment rails directly into spend automation, making switching prohibitively expensive.
Company Research
Zip is a procurement technology company that provides an AI platform for enterprise procurement orchestration, intake, and spend management [1]
Founded: 2020 [5]
Founders: Rujul Zaparde and Lu Cheng [1]
Employees: Not publicly disclosed [1]
Headquarters: San Francisco, California [1]
Funding/Valuation: Valued at $2.2 billion as of October 2024 Series D round, with total funding of $371 million [4][5]
Mission: Build the AI operating system for spend [1]
The company's strengths rely on the combination of AI-powered procurement automation, rapid deployment capabilities, and comprehensive spend management platform. [1][6][7]
• AI-Driven Automation: Uses purpose-built AI agents to automate global sourcing, compliance, and spend processes across the entire intake-to-pay workflow [7]
• Fast Implementation: Deploying Zip takes eight weeks or less for standard implementation using no-code configuration approach, compared to traditional procurement implementations that stretch six months or longer [6]
• Comprehensive Platform: Orchestrates the entire intake-to-pay process with integrated payment processing capabilities, having processed more than $10 billion in 2024 [5][7]

Business Model Analysis
🚨Problem
Enterprise procurement suffers from fragmented systems, manual processes, and lack of spend visibility [6]
• Subscription management happens through scattered spreadsheets leading to surprise renewals and price increases [6]
• Traditional procurement implementations take six months or longer due to complex customization requirements [6]
• Companies lack centralized contract information and proper stakeholder involvement [6]
• Manual procurement processes create compliance risks and inefficiencies [7]

🏢Existing Alternatives
Traditional procurement platforms including SAP Ariba, Coupa, and Procurify [10][11][12]
• SAP Ariba with larger focus on procurement automation as part of digital transformation initiatives [10]
• Coupa as established procurement platform with higher cost structure [11]
• Procurify offering 80% of Coupa's functionality for lower cost [11]
• Procuredesk, Procurement Express, and Precoro as budget-friendly alternatives [11]

📅History
Founded in 2020 and achieved $2.2 billion valuation within four years [1][5]
• 2020: Company founded by Rujul Zaparde and Lu Cheng [1]
• Early stage: Secured funding from Y Combinator, CRV, and other investors [5]
• 2024: Processed over $10 billion in payments [5]
• October 2024: Raised $190 million Series D at $2.2 billion valuation [2][4]
• 2024: Named a Visionary in 2026 Gartner Magic Quadrant [2]
